I would like to setup my linux webserver to forward on all mail to another machine on my LAN. I have a static ip for the webserver but would use private ip (192.168....) for my other machine. The webserver machine also serves as a gateway to the net and already has ip masquerading on it. Can someone tell me what I need to do in order for all mail to be forwarded on to my other machine?
